Current Landscape of Prosthetics Accessibility

As of 2023, the gap in prosthetic accessibility remains significant, particularly in developing nations. In regions such as Southeast Asia and countries like Indonesia, many individuals cannot afford prosthetic devices that can cost thousands of dollars. This situation is compounded by limited availability of healthcare resources and trained professionals. The recent initiative aims to tackle these challenges head-on, creating partnerships with NGOs and local governments to improve distribution channels and reduce costs.

Technological Innovations

The initiative emphasizes leveraging cutting-edge technologies in prosthetic design. Innovations such as 3D printing and bioengineering are set to revolutionize how prosthetics are produced. These technologies not only enhance the functionality of prosthetics but also lower production costs, making devices more accessible. For example, 3D-printed prosthetics can be created for just a fraction of the traditional costs, opening up possibilities for mass production in regions like Bali and Surabaya.
